Chronic pain is a global problem. The usual treatments for pain relief are nonsteroidal anti-inflammatory drugs (NSAIDs) and prescription opioid medications. Many people complain that these medications offer inadequate pain relief and are can have adverse effects. As states legalize medical marijuana, it is becoming a popular alternative to prescription and over-the-counter pain medications.
This course discusses the difference and similarities of TCH and CBD, the health effects of each, and the recommended guidelines for medicinal cannabis use.
